About Marching Southerners
Welcome To The Southerners Website! A nationally known arm of Jacksonville State University , the Marching Southerners have been defining the future of marching band for over SIXTY YEARS. Comprised of students from all over the country, the Southerners perform for thousands each season - sending chills up the spine and tears down the face.
